I was trying to think of a subject, and a little item in my room caught my eye--my clothes pin with washi tape. It is so cute and is actually useful-the gap in the tip of the clothespin exactly hugs my phone charging cord, so I leave it clipped to the cord, and when the phone's not charging, the clothespin stops the cord from slipping away.

​I also like a good fountain pen. It's satisfying to write a note or letter with a fountain pen. And it's even more satisfying to write a letter while steeping a cup of tea (or coffee if you prefer) especially if you have a cute mug rug to put your cup/mug on.  I prefer a mug rug to a coaster because a mug rug gives me more room to set my spoon down. And a cute mug rag makes you smile every time you pick up or set down your mug.
